【题目】Today almost everyone knows computers and the Internet. If I ask you “What is the most important in your life?” , maybe you will say “Computers and the Internet.”

The first computer was made in 1946. it was very big but it worked slowly. Today computers are getting smaller and smaller. But they work faster and faster. What can computers do? A writer has said, “People can’t live without computers today.”

The Internet came a little later than computers. It is about twenty-five years later than computers. But now it can be found almost everywhere. We can use it to read books, writer letters, do shopping, play computer games or make friends.

Many students like the Internet very much. They often go into the Internet as soon as they are free. They make friends on the Internet and maybe they have never seen these friends. They don’tknow their real names, ages, and even sex. They are so interested in making the “unreal friends” that they can’t put their hearts into study. Many of them can’t catch up with others on many subjects because of that.

We can use computers and the Internet to learn more about the world. But at the same time, we should remember that not all the things can be done by computers and the Internet.

Would you like to have an electric car? Do you know this kind of quiet and clean cars run on electricity(电)?

In the future, more and more people will have cars, so the cars will be in great need. But the oil won’t keep up with the number of cars on the road. So the price of oil will go up.

Electric cars aren’t perfect just yet. It can take eight hours to charge(充电) a car for only 100 miles of driving. How far that car travels depends on the weather and traffic.

Price is a problem, too. Electric cars cost much more than cars using oil. The good news is that electric-car technology(技术) is getting better. As it does, the prices of this kind of cars are going down.

To charge the car, the US Department of Energy is paying for at least 10,000 charging stations around the country. And it will cost about three dollars for each charge.

Now carmakers are looking for other ways to make the car cheaper. Then more people will use electric cars, and we’ll have a clean and nice world in the future.
